The Yorkshire giants bid for £13m for Huddersfield Town midfielder Lewis O’Brien, only to see their deal denied.
According to Football Insider, the 22-year-old is keen on linking up with Marcelo Bielsa’s side and Leeds are bound to make a renewed deal for the youngster.

Apparently, four bids have already been made for him and a fifth one is on the cards. A deal is to be confirmed in January’s winter transfer window.
Huddersfield reportedly want a higher price for him.
